8:50 Random inspections of those leaving, and a line begins to form. Traffic entering flows freely. Israeli vehicles aren't allowed to pass. A pickup truck carrying young men is stopped at the exit; they're made to get out of the truck, their ID's checked, they lift their shirts, and they can continue to the next checkpoint.
Qalqiliya
9:30 A line of 15 cars at the entrance, but traffic flows. Drivers waiting on line called encouragement to us. Israeli Arabs who live in Qalqilya may only enter the city in a vehicle registered in their name (not that of a family member). Not having any choice, they park before getting to the checkpoint and take a taxi into Qalqiliya.
